欢迎来到天天文库
浏览记录
ID:5389409
大小:1.06 MB
页数:4页
时间:2017-12-08
《基于lin通信与labview平台电机控制上位机系统设计》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、自A动控制I2016年第3期utocontrol-’’基于LIN通信与Labview平台的电机控制上位机系统设计涂文特(贵州航天林泉电机有限公司,贵州贵阳550000)摘要:在Labviw平台下,通过解析LIN通信LDF格式数据库与文本配置文件,搭建电机控制上位机程序框架,设计了一款能够实现电机系统正常控制、状态显示、耐久试验、数据记录、波形显示与存储等功能的上位机软件。该控制系统具备性能稳定、低成本、高效率、高灵活性、可移植性优异等优点,可灵活应用于各种数据采集及处理项目中,解决了系统设计复杂
2、和移植困难等问题,使用状况验证了该系统的合理性与实用性。关键词:LabviewLIN电机控制上位机中图分类号:TM306文献标识码:A文章编号:1002—6886(2016)03—0087—04DesignofahostcomputersystemformotorcontrolbasedonLINcommunicationandLabviewTUWenteAbstract:ThroughanalysisofLDFandthetextconfigurationfileofLINcommunicat
3、ion,webuiltahostcomputerprogramframeworkonLabviewplatform,anddesignedahostcomputersoftwarewiththefunctionsofmotorsystemcontrol,statusdisplay,endurancetest,datarecordandstorage,waveformdisplay,etc.Thesystemhasstableperformance,lowcost,higheficiency,hi
4、ghflexibilityandgoodportability,thuscanbeusedinvariousdatacollectionandprocessingprojects,andcansolvetheproblemsofcomplexityindesignanddificultyinporting.Thepracticehasconfirmedtherationalityandpracticalityofthesystem.Keywords:Labview;LIN;motorcontro
5、l;hostcomputer提供信号处理、配置、识别和诊断功能。通过LIN通O引言信方式在Labview平台上搭建数据采集(DAQ)系电机设计完成后,还需经过样机试制,经过测试统,以实现电机运行参数采集和进行环境耐久试验,找出电机性能上的偏差,进而进行测试、调试、定控制系统具备开发简单、可移植性强等优点。型¨J。因此除了要对电机和控制器系统进行研制1程序框架设计外,还需增加上位机控制系统,辅助完成对电机及控制器的日常和耐久测试,并按需保存试验数据及波电机控制上位机主要实现与电机控制器的通信形。常
6、见的控制系统上位机通常采用MFC、Lab—功能,并能发送电机启停、给定速度、数据记录、波形view、QT等平台搭建设计J。其中MFC和QT平显示等功能。以某电机控制平台为例,上位机系统台采用c++语言进行编程,而Labview平台则采用应具备图1中程序框架内的实体内容。在登录界面图形化编程的G语言方式进行设计,且提供了丰富中设置波特率、COM口、LDF数据库路径等参数。的扩展函数库,广泛应用于军事、航天、航空等领域。工作模式可在手动与自动模式之间进行切换。手动LIN是一种基于UART/SCI(通
7、用异步收发器/串行模式下可完成电机正常性能测试,当需实现某项耐通信接口)的低成本串行通信协议。该通信方式具久环境类型的试验时,可切换到自动模式以达到无备一主多从网络节点、低成本、配置简单、可预测人值守等功能。此外,在上位机界面上应具备电机EMC等特点,广泛应用于汽车上低速通信部分,且实时状态反馈,方便试验人员观察电机运行参数及.{j7.
此文档下载收益归作者所有